## Insurance Renewal – Managers Only

Quick heads-up, team: our liability cover with Harrowgate Mutual renews at end of quarter. Premiums are up roughly 8%, but Priya negotiated better terms on fleet coverage for the Delmont branch. Nothing you need to action yet, just keep it in mind when quoting big contracts. Context for the renewal decision is below.

board note of bawep-tajef: Queniusek Systems plans to raise the Quenvan list price by 53.1 percent in March. The pricing group signed off on a budget of $176.4 million for Project Drueth. The renewal with Casionix Partners closes at $142.5 million a year, 8.3 percent below the last contract. Project Fraax slips by six weeks because of the tooling delay.

If your plugin starts reporting weird humidity or temperature values from a Verdantly greenhouse controller, you're probably seeing sensor drift. Don't correct readings inside your plugin — the core scheduler applies calibration offsets itself, and double-correcting makes things worse. Just flag the channel as suspect and let the controller recalibrate. The drift thresholds and the flagging API are documented on the page below.

runbook for badug-kadup: https://confluence.zemvarlabs.internal/projects/browse/display/projects/bd1b

### Feedwright validator stalls

Symptom: Feedwright stops emitting validation verdicts; queue depth climbs.

Check worker heartbeats first. If dead, restart the pool — state is rebuilt from the Ostermill ledger automatically. Do not truncate the pending table; duplicates are deduped downstream.

If restarts fail with auth errors, the credential likely expired during rotation. Re-authenticate against the internal Ostermill ledger service using the key below.

API key for kahop-bagef: zpat2_yb